NEW PRODUCT!

Purity Feed and Ritchie Industries are pleased to announce the launch of the Omni 10 waterer. The new waterer is set to join the already very popular line-up of OmniFounts. Customers have been waiting for a large capacity waterer ever since the popular Cattle Fountain 10 was phased out in 2005, but most should find it was worth the wait. The Omni 10 features an all-around drinking area and like other members of the OmniFount family, it has a 304 stainless steel trough with heat elements attached to the underside for excellent frost-free service under even the most severe winter conditions. The heavy duty polyethylene constructed body is insulated with highly energy efficient polyurethane foam, providing an R-value of at least 14. The large trough holds 28 gallons of water and has an animal capacity of 275 head of cattle and 135 head of dairy.

TerraLink Horticulture Soft Launches Earth Link Program

Terra Link Horticulture is in the process of launching a new program to capitalize on the growing trend of eco-friendly products. The program is supposed to include a full line of products to meet the needs of landscapers while maintaining a high level of environmental accountability. Once fully developed, the Earth Link program claims it will include customer information on product content, application, expected release, weather reaction, and even environmental footprint. TerraLink believes that Landscapers will benefit from their new program by marketing themselves as progressive and environmentally conscious, and includes signage, advertising and statement stuffers with the program.
